Online Degree
With the world become more and more centered on the World Wide Web, it is not surprising to see how many fields of study are available in the form of an online degree. With economic hardships in the form of more and more wants, people are finding they have to choose between work and school. And unfortunately for many young, ambitious people putting food on the table became a greater priority and they dropped out from school in order to join the workforce for a job – not a career.
However, with the onset of online degrees, it has become possible for people to get the best of both worlds; they can still work as well as attend school – even if it does mean listening to a lecture at 1AM and turning in an assignment before the crack of dawn.
Virtual Doors Wide Open
Students worldwide have been quick to run towards this opportunity and are finding colleges and universities only too eager to open their virtual doors to students in a variety of fields. From online degrees in interior design, accountancy, paralegal, culinary arts, web design, graphic design and journalism, such fields are just the tip of the iceberg when it comes to options in online degrees.
Even more scientific fields that have a more hands-on approach also offer some portions of the theory parts of the course online and then going to school physically for the more practical aspects of study. Online degrees are even easier on your wallet. Due to the fact that universities do not have to provide you with the classroom, the furniture, the supplies and most importantly a live professor, they can pass on some of the savings to you when you sign up for an online degree. However, always make sure that the school you choose is reputed and accredited by the state in which it operates so that all your time, money and effort pay off in the form of a great job and a rewarding career.
